Reid makes it a high five

Plymouth top scorer Reuben Reid took his tally to five goals in six games as John Sheridan's Pilgrims beat 10-man Southend 2-0 at Home Park.

The hosts took a 52nd minute lead when attacking midfielder Lewis Alessandra picked his spot with a side foot finish from 10 yards following Kelvin Mellor's mazy run and cutback from the right.

Mellor and Alessandra combined down the right to tee up striker Reid to head home from eight yards out on 67 minutes.

Plymouth right back Mellor cleared off the line to deny Southend striker Barry Corr as he swooped at the far post to convert Myles Weston's cross from the right in the eighth minute.

Southend were forced to change their line-up on 15 minutes when central defender Cian Bolger was dismissed for a second bookable offence for fouling Plymouth target man Marcus Morgan. Bolger had been cautioned for a foul on Morgan in the opening minutes.

In first half stoppage time Carl McHugh's free kick from the right was headed just wide by Plymouth Reid.

Plymouth made better of their one-man advantage in the second half with Southend keeper Daniel Bentley forced to make a brilliant full length diving save to push McHugh's goal-bound header wide.
